Emaya has announced the 15th edition of the Opticaigua 2024 photography competition. This event, which has been a tradition since 2007, had to be interrupted in 2019 and 2020 due to the pandemic. In 2024, the theme of the competition is “Aigua per a la pau” (Water for peace), as water can generate peace or provoke conflict. When water is scarce or polluted, or when people have unequal or no access to it, tensions can rise. Public health and prosperity, food and energy systems, economic productivity and environmental integrity depend on a well-functioning and equitable management of the water cycle. That is why the competition suggests thinking about how we should use water as a tool to create a more peaceful and prosperous world for all.

Opticaigua 2024 competition deadlines

The deadline for submitting photographs is 22 March and ends on 1 May. Each participant may submit only one photograph of their own authorship, which must be related to the theme of the competition and accompanied by a title. Participants must be residents of Mallorca. The images must be sent in JPG format, with a maximum size of 5 MB, through the website www.opticaigua.com.

The jury will award the following prizes:

  • First prize: €1500 voucher to be used for photography products at Foto Ruano.
  • Second prize: €750 voucher to be used for photography products at Foto Ruano.
  • Third prize: €350 voucher to be used for photography products at Foto Ruano.
  • 10 runners-up prizes: €60 voucher for photo prints at Foto Ruano.

The names of the winners of the competition will be published on the website www.opticaigua.com on 29 May 2024. Once the winning images of the Opticaigua 2024 photography competition have been selected, an exhibition will be held in the Misericòrdia chapel, where the best photographs will be on display from 30 May to 15 June. The prizes will be awarded on 30 May 2024 at 19:00, coinciding with the opening of the exhibition.
